Serving Denton

Since 2007, we have served the Denton, Texas area. Our hope is that, through our ministry, Denton will experience the grace, joy, and freedom of the gospel. Our desire is to serve in a way that challenges and changes our community and glorifies God.

PCA Affiliation

We are a “Reformed” denomination, striving to be faithful to the scriptures, true to the reformed faith, and obedient to the Great Commission of Jesus Christ. For more information about PCA, visit PCAnet.org
